Step 1: A trigonal bipyramidal electron geometry corresponds to a steric number of 5 (5 electron domains). Step 2: The geometries that result from a steric number of 5 are: see-saw (4 bps + 1 lp), T-shaped (3 bps + 2 lps), and linear (2 bps + 3 lps). Step 3: A trigonal planar molecular geometry results from a steric number of 3 (3 bps + 0 lps, sp2 hybridized) and is not a derivative of a trigonal bipyramidal arrangement. This matches option (a).
